Job Title: Lab Technician 4

Job Description

We are seeking a dedicated Lab Technician 4 who will play a crucial role in supporting hardware development, validation, and lab operations across silicon, systems, networking, and infrastructure programs. The ideal candidate will demonstrate strong hands-on hardware skills, combined with expertise in scripting, automation, networking, and datacenter operations.

Responsibilities

  • Instrument prototype servers and development platforms using serial consoles, UART interfaces, debug ports, and other engineering tools.
  • Install, configure, cable, and validate servers, racks, networking equipment, and lab infrastructure.
  • Support hardware bring-up activities, system integration efforts, and validation testing.
  • Assist engineering teams in diagnosing platform, firmware, and hardware issues throughout the product lifecycle.
  • Perform break-fix activities, preventative maintenance, and system sustainment support.
  • Develop and maintain automation scripts using Python, Bash, PowerShell, or similar scripting languages.
  • Create tools to simplify deployment, validation, inventory tracking, test execution, and operational workflows.
  • Assist with datacenter and laboratory operations, including rack deployment, hardware installation, cable management, equipment moves, and maintenance.
  • Support space planning, rack preparation, power validation, and environmental readiness activities.
  • Manage lab inventory, consumables, spare components, and test equipment.
  • Assist with network deployment, subnet troubleshooting, switch configuration, and connectivity validation.
  • Work closely with networking and IT teams to resolve connectivity and configuration problems.
  • Drive issue resolution by coordinating across multiple organizations and stakeholders.
  • Ensure compliance with lab safety requirements, ESD controls, operational procedures, and security processes.

Essential Skills

  • 5+ years of experience supporting hardware development labs, datacenters, manufacturing labs, or validation environments.
  • Experience with server hardware, rack integration, bring-up, deployment, and troubleshooting.
  • Experience with serial communications, UARTs, console access, and low-level system debug.
  • Experience scripting with Python, Bash, PowerShell, or similar languages.
  • Knowledge of networking fundamentals including switching, VLANs, subnets, routing, and connectivity troubleshooting.
  • Strong troubleshooting and root-cause analysis skills.
  • Ability to work effectively across engineering, operations, and infrastructure teams.

Additional Skills & Qualifications

  • Experience supporting silicon development or platform validation programs.
  • Familiarity with Linux administration and hardware validation environments.
  • Experience using oscilloscopes, protocol analyzers, logic analyzers, or other engineering instrumentation.
  • Experience supporting large-scale cloud, server, AI, or datacenter hardware platforms.
  • Experience with inventory management systems, automation frameworks, or lab operation tooling.

Work Environment

The Lab Operations Engineer will work in a dynamic environment focused on hardware development and validation, partnering closely with engineering, lab operations, system integration, and IT teams. The role involves deploying, maintaining, troubleshooting, and scaling development lab environments, ensuring operational readiness and compliance with safety and security protocols.
